A P2P-Based Hybrid Parallel Algorithm for Online-Checking Protection SettingChinese Full Text

LIU Gaoming;SONG Wei;QIU Xiangdong;North China Electric Power University;Beijing Join Bright Digital Power Technology Limited Company;

Abstract: Taking into account the gradually expanded scale of large interconnected power system,especially the UHV synchronous grid successfully puts into operation. Traditional centralized computing will encounter the bottleneck of hardware computing power. A protection setting online checking hybrid parallel algorithm based on P2P is proposed. Peer-to-peer communications using P2P network technology to achieve inter-regional information fast interactive. The design of MPI + OpenMP hybrid parallel programming models and algorithms is emphatically introduced. Online checking two levels parallel of process-level and thread-level is achieved through the parallel analysis of online checking. Finally,the hybrid parallel algorithm was tested and compared based on P2P technology distributed parallel computing platform. The results show that the proposed algorithm is correct and effective.
